Hand Sanitizer Use Out and About | Handwashing | CDC

Aug 10, 2021·Use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er that contains at least 60% alcohol. Supervise young children when they use hand sanitizer to prevent swallowing alcohol, especially in schools and childcare facilities. Put enough sanitizer on your hands to cover all surfaces. Rub your hands together until they feel dry (this should take around 20 seconds).

Disposal of alcohol based hand sanitizer

Disposal of alcohol based hand sanitizer Drafted 9/29/09 Most hand sanitizing liquids and gels consist of 60% or greater concentrations of ethyl alcohol. Alcohol based hand sanitizing fluids are flammable liquids at room temperature. As a result, any unused or partially used containers of hand sanitizing liquid that are no ...
